Knit a mosaic masterpiece in two colors of Quarry for style you can take to the city or the country. This striking coat is worked flat in one piece to the underarms, with increases forming slanted fronts that fasten with a single large closure. The sleeves are also knit flat, and the double-ribbed bands and dramatic collar are worked on stitches picked up from the body once seaming is complete. Mosaic knitting uses only one color per row, slipping the stitches that will appear to form the foreground, so it doesn’t create as thick and dense a fabric as stranded colorwork would.

Worked in both chunky weight Quarry and DK weight Arbor yarns, the Normandale cardigan is a feat in design ingenuity. Knit flat in one piece to the underarms, each row of the main body is worked using just one color with stitches of the other color slipped along the way to create a nubbly mosaic motif reminiscent of Portland’s many bridges. Slightly sloping shoulders and no body shaping make Normandale an excellent cardigan for wearers of any gender. A shawl collar worked in brioche stitch adds extra oomph to this standout design.

For distinctive tailored style, knit a sleek coat with a flared peplum and handkerchief hem. Twisted rib and ladder motifs create long, flattering lines on the flat-knit fronts and center back. A twisted-rib cable with a self facing folded inside and sewn down provides a decorative and stable edge for the snap closures, and a swing-coat style collar in twisted rib makes a clean and structural finish. The peplum, a simple rectangle with I-cord selvedges, is worked from stitches picked up after garment assembly.

Wrap up in contemporary fall style: a swingy open-front coat knit from cozy Quarry. The original crosshatch stitch pattern, worked from a chart and easily memorized, forms a fabric with bands of deep texture. The body is worked flat in one piece with decreases shaping a gentle A-line; long sleeves (designed to be cuffed back) are knit in the round and then joined to work a circular yoke. The front bands and collar are picked up and knit in single rib, with short rows shaping the collar. A single toggle allows you to close the fronts if desired.

The generous shawl collar of this richly textured classic pullover will keep you nice and warm. The simple, bold, mirrored cables on a ground of moss stitch create flattering vertical lines on the body and can be worked from written instructions or from charts, according to your preference. Millisande is knit in the round from the bottom up to the underarms without shaping; the yoke and set-in sleeve caps are completed flat and shaped with sloped bind-offs for tidy, traditional construction. After seaming, the collar is shaped by picking up stitches first from the back neck.

An airy fabric of Loft knit on the bias creates a beautifully draping coat to wear open or smartly belted. Cleverly spaced narrow stripes emphasize the bias construction, flatter the figure, and allow for myriad color effects from subtle tone on tone to playful melding of brights, from dramatic high contrast pairings to subtly shifting gradients. Pente is knit from the bottom up with a folded hem; short rows shape the shoulders and sleeves, which are cast on at the underarm and joined along the top with an exposed bind-off to provide stability and highlight the construction.

Leander begins with twisted rib, morphing into a traveling current of brioche rib shaped to follow a sinuous course by a combination of decorative increases and decreases. This directional shaping also lends gentle curves along the scarf’s outer edges, fluidly framing the neck and the shoulders when draped. Worked in woolen-spun Shelter, Leander makes for a gratifying combination of tactile indulgence and lofty warmth. This scarf is worked in two pieces, each from the cast-on edge to the center; the pieces are then joined. The long edges are finished with a knit-in I-cord edging.
